The RTOS with PIC Microcontroller Programing certification specializes in Real Time Operating Systems (RTOS) coupled with Programmable Interface Controller (PIC) microcontrollers. It encompasses Real-time software design skills and comprehensive programming. The RTOS provides Priority-based scheduling, Inter-task communication and Synchronization, enabling Real-time multitasking. PIC microcontrollers offer flexibility in optimizing product designs. Industries use this certification to develop real-time embedded systems across sects as diverse as automotive, consumer electronics, and industrial automation. The collaboration of RTOS and PIC microcontrollers guarantees efficient system performance, control accuracy and predictability, crucial to the industrial setup for developing modern electronics.

RTOS with PIC Microcontroller Programming Certification Training is designed for professionals seeking expertise in Real-Time Operating Systems (RTOS) and microcontroller programming. The curriculum covers theory and hands-on working with PIC Microcontrollers, implementation of multitasking mechanisms, understanding of RTOS principles, and application deployment. Course topics also include task management, handling synchronization, scheduling algorithms, and understanding kernel objects. This training focuses on enhancing your skills to develop and debug high-performance applications on microcontrollers using real-time operating systems.
